Step 1
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F and line a muffin tray with 6 muffin papers (or spray with cooking oil).
Step 2
Drain the chickpeas into a colander and give them a shake to remove any excess liquid.
Step 3
Transfer the beans to a blender (or food processor), along with the rest of the ingredients for the muffins except for the chocolate chips. Blend until completely smooth. Stir in the chocolate chips.
Step 4
Fill the muffin papers up ¾ of the way with muffin batter and sprinkle with additional chocolate chips if desired.
Step 5
Bake for 30 to 35 minutes, or until the muffins are golden-brown around the edges and test clean.
Step 6
Allow muffins to cool completely before peeling off the muffin papers to eat.
